Key components of digital readiness

To develop digital readiness, individuals need to possess a set of key components that enable them to effectively engage with digital technologies. These components include:

  1. Technological skills: This refers to the ability to use and navigate various digital tools, software, and devices. It includes proficiency in using common applications, operating systems, and online platforms.

  2. Digital literacy: Digital literacy encompasses the ability to find, evaluate, and utilize digital information effectively. It involves critical thinking skills to discern the reliability and credibility of online sources and the ability to use digital tools for research, communication, and problem-solving.

  3. Adaptability and flexibility: In a rapidly evolving digital landscape, being adaptable and flexible is crucial. Digital readiness requires individuals to embrace change, learn new technologies, and adapt their skills and knowledge to meet evolving digital demands.

  4. Cybersecurity awareness: With the increasing prevalence of cyber threats, individuals need to be aware of cybersecurity risks and take appropriate measures to protect themselves online. This includes understanding the importance of strong passwords, recognizing phishing attempts, and practicing safe browsing habits.

  5. Critical thinking and problem-solving skills: Digital readiness involves the ability to think critically and solve problems in a digital context. This includes analyzing and evaluating information, troubleshooting technical issues, and finding innovative solutions using digital tools and resources.

By developing these key components, individuals can enhance their digital readiness and effectively navigate the digital landscape.

Addressing the digital divide

The digital divide refers to the gap between those who have access to digital technologies and those who do not. This divide can be based on factors such as socioeconomic status, geographic location, or age. It is crucial to address this challenge to ensure that everyone has equal opportunities to develop digital readiness.

To address the digital divide, governments, organizations, and communities need to work together to provide access to digital technologies and resources to underserved populations. This can include initiatives such as providing affordable internet access, offering technology training programs, and creating digital literacy resources in multiple languages. By bridging the digital divide, we can empower individuals to become digitally ready and participate fully in the digital age.

Managing cybersecurity risks and privacy concerns

As we become more digitally connected, it is essential to be aware of cybersecurity risks and privacy concerns. The increasing prevalence of cyber threats and data breaches highlights the importance of taking steps to protect our digital identities and personal information.

To manage cybersecurity risks and privacy concerns, it is crucial to stay informed about the latest threats and best practices for online security. This includes using strong and unique passwords, enabling two-factor authentication, being cautious of phishing attempts, and regularly updating software and applications. Additionally, be mindful of the information you share online and consider adjusting privacy settings on social media platforms and other online accounts. By taking proactive measures, you can minimize the risks and enjoy the benefits of the digital world securely.
